Sail Biomedicines is seeking a scientist to advance our lipid nanoparticle (LNP) manufacturing platform for nucleic acid therapeutics. Sail Biomedicines is seeking a highly talented and self-motivated individual to develop and operationalize lipid nanoparticle formulations at pre-clinical and pilot lab scales. The successful candidate will contribute to preclinical pipeline programs, working at interface of manufacturing, formulation science, analytical characterization, and process development.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Design, formulate, and characterize lipid nanoparticle (LNP) systems for nucleic acid delivery across preclinical manufacturing and technology development stages.
  • Develop, optimize and operationalize formulation processes and scale-up approaches (e.g., TFF, ultrafiltration)
  • Troubleshoot formulation and process challenges to enhance robustness, reproducibility, and scalability
  • Generate high-quality, reproducible data and maintain thorough documentation in electronic lab notebooks
  • Prepare LNP formulations to support internal research and partner programs
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with analytical, translational and platform teams to advance pre-clincial manufacturing and pilot lab goals
  • Present data and insights clearly to internal teams and contribute to scientific discussions and decision-making

PROFESSIONAL EXPERIENCE & QUALIFICATIONS
  • 4+ years (M.Sc.) or 6+ years (B.Sc.) of relevant industry experience in LNP formulation optimizations and drug delivery with strong background in nucleic acid therapeutics and education in life sciences or engineering (Pharmaceutical Sciences, Biomedical Engineering, Biochemistry, etc)
    • Level (Associate Scientist or Scientist I) will be determined based on experience, technical expertise, and demonstrated impact.
  • Hands-on experience in nanoparticle or LNP formulation and characterization
  • Strong understanding of drug delivery systems, particularly for nucleic acid therapeutics
  • Experience with nanoparticle characterization techniques (e.g., DLS, zeta potential, fluorescence-based assays such as Ribogreen, chromatography)
  • Demonstrated ability to design, execute, and troubleshoot experiments independently
  • Strong data analysis, documentation, and communication skills

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
  • Familiarity with formulation process technologies (e.g., microfluidic mixers, pumping systems, TFF)
  • Experience supporting in vivo studies or translating formulations from research to preclinical scale
